RIL Retail opens up 1,840 new shops in FY24, ET Retail

.Reliance Retail opened 1,840 new outlets in FY24 also as it authorized a multitude of handle international companies, the conglomerate uncovered in its yearly record on Wednesday. The retail organization of the oil-to-retail empire signed up an EBITDA of Rs 23,802, in FY24, documenting a growth of 28.4% YoY." The business remained to steer development by means of a selection adapted for intended consumer sections as well as extended in the right catchment places via new store positions," the yearly record stated.Moreover, the empire viewed a rise in its retail customer foundation, along with 300 thousand consumers looking to its own retail subsidiaries, the report showed. "The enrolled consumer base went across a breakthrough of 300 million, making Dependence Retail among the most preferred merchants in the nation," the annual report said. Even further, the corporation pointed out that the retail branch is set to widen its offerings. For FY24, Reliance retail formed several strategic alliances, as well as acquisitions, hence bolstering its own public offerings, the file added.Reliance retail undertook equity fund raising of Rs 17,814, along with your business recording over a billion footfalls throughout its own outlets.
